A Quick and Easy Guide to Maintain Your Child’s Oral Health
Early childhood is the prime time to establish a healthy
lifestyle. It is essential to integrate oral hygiene into the general health
habits of children from the beginning so they are conscious of their dental
care.
Tooth decay is commonly increasing in Indian children as more than
half of 6 years old are having tooth decay in baby teeth or adult teeth. Tooth decay not only destroys a tooth but also causes crowding problems in adult
teeth at a later stage. Thus, it is vital to care for your child’s teeth from
as early as they start teething.
ü Start Caring at an Early Age
·
Brushing teeth
twice a day with circular motions.
·
Praise your child
for brushing teeth itself as it will instill confidence in the child.
·
Replace the toothbrush
of your child every 3 months.
·
Supervise them in
flossing until they are 10 and demonstrate the process yourself.

ü Develop Healthy Eating Habits
·
They
should develop a balanced diet of fruits, vegetables, meats, and dry fruits to
ensure healthy teeth for children.
·
Minimize
the sugar intake like chocolates, cookies, toffees, etc.
· Avoid giving fast-food very often.
